The Peperomia 'Glabella', also known as Cypress Peperomia, is a resilient perennial houseplant cherished for its deep jade, succulent-like foliage. This plant is remarkably easy to care for, making it ideal for both novice and experienced plant enthusiasts. Its oval-shaped leaves efficiently retain water, contributing to its drought tolerance. The 'Glabella' can grow in a rosette form or develop trailing stems, adding a dynamic visual element to any indoor setting. While it produces subtle flower spikes, its primary allure is its attractive, water-storing leaves, a testament to its low-maintenance charm.
